Boeing Defense, Space & Security (BDS), Space, Intelligence & Weapons Systems (SI&WS) is seeking a talented Propulsion Systems Engineer with expertise in fluid systems to join our Experimental Systems Group (ESG) at Kennedy Space Center, FL.
ESG supports diverse government customers across multiple cutting-edge technology domains within a fast-paced, agile development environment focused on delivering innovative capabilities quickly and cost-effectively.
Our portfolio includes a broad array of advanced platforms and technologies, notably the X-37B the world’s first fully autonomous reusable spaceplane.
